Made in India, Made for the World: India's Wind Power Converter Manufacturing Reaches New Scale India's wind sector is crossing a meaningful manufacturing milestone. For years, much of the critical equipment inside turbines—especially converters that stabilize wind's variable output for the grid—has been imported. This dependency left Indian wind projects exposed to shipping delays, customs bottlenecks, and currency fluctuations.
